What affects the price

The final price for your flooring project depends on a few moving parts. First, the material itself—hardwood or luxury vinyl—will shift the total significantly. You also have to consider the square footage of the space and the current condition of your subfloor. Tack on factors like stairs, furniture moving, and the complexity of the layout, and you have your total. Exact pricing confirmed free on the call.

Which is better, vinyl plank or laminate?

Vinyl plank flooring is an excellent choice for Glendale homes due to its superior water resistance, making it ideal for kitchens and bathrooms. Laminate can be a more affordable option and still offers good durability and aesthetics. Discuss your room's specific needs with the installer.

What type of flooring is most popular now?

Luxury vinyl plank (LVP) and engineered hardwood are highly popular in the Glendale area. LVP is favored for its resilience and waterproof qualities, while engineered hardwood offers a sophisticated, natural look. Many residents appreciate their ability to handle the climate.
